Tim Krul delighted with "massive win" for Newcastle United

Newcastle United goalkeeper Tim Krul hails his side's "massive" win over Cardiff City in the Premier League.

Newcastle United goalkeeper Tim Krul has said that today's 2-1 win away at Cardiff City was "massive".

Loic Remy's first-half brace put the Magpies 2-0 up at the break, and although Peter Odemwingie pulled a goal back for Cardiff in the second period, Krul's side held on to secure their first victory in three games.

"It was a massive win," Krul told BBC Sport. "All week we have had pressure on us but we came out fighting and got three massive points.

"We've had to stick together because we've made some individual mistakes recently, but we've not been playing that badly.

"They put us under pressure but we defended well and created a lot of chances."

The win moves Newcastle up to 10th place in the Premier League table.
